The weather looked a bit dodgy at first &#8211; despite promises of glorious sunshine, it was raining as I left Inverness &#8211; but it soon dried up and I spent the vast majority of the day in a T-shirt (with plenty of suncream on).<\/p>\n<p>I love cycling on the Black Isle, which, as we always like to point out at work, is neither black nor an island. It&#8217;s a classic tourist brochure phrase that makes us chuckle every time! The views on the peninsula are fantastic, from the forests to the open views across the Moray Firth. I got a great aerial view of Fort George today, looking down from the road between Janefield and Cromarty.<\/p>\n<p>There were plenty of other folk out and about on their bikes, too, which always makes me happy. I saw a family up at Learnie, a couple of guys with a trailer and panniers near Tore who I guess were on their way to John o&#8217;Groats and a number of cyclists on the Cromarty Firth side of the Black Isle.<\/p>\n<p>It&#8217;s a joy that the spring has finally sprung and people are making the most of it.
